The Production Possibilities Frontier (PPF) is a cornerstone concept in economics, illustrating the trade-offs societies face when allocating scarce resources between the production of different goods and services. It serves as a visual representation of efficiency, opportunity cost, and economic growth, offering insights into resource allocation and the potential output of an economy.

Understanding the Production Possibilities Frontier

The Production Possibilities Frontier, sometimes referred to as the Production Possibility Curve, provides a simplified model of an economy's potential output. It makes several key assumptions:

  • Fixed Resources: The total quantity of available resources, such as labor, capital, and land, is fixed within the timeframe being considered.
  • Fixed Technology: The technology used to transform resources into goods and services remains constant.
  • Full Employment: All available resources are being used efficiently and fully employed.
  • Two Goods: The model simplifies the economy by considering the production of only two goods or services. This allows for easy graphical representation and analysis.

Given these assumptions, the PPF shows the maximum combinations of two goods that can be produced if all resources are used efficiently. Here's the thing — points inside the curve represent inefficient production, indicating that resources are not being fully utilized or are being used ineffectively. Points on the curve represent efficient production levels, meaning that more of one good can only be produced by producing less of the other. Points outside the curve are unattainable with the current level of resources and technology.

The shape of the PPF is usually concave (bowed outwards). On the flip side, this reflects the principle of increasing opportunity cost. Here's the thing — as an economy shifts resources from the production of one good to another, the opportunity cost of producing the second good increases. This is because resources are not perfectly adaptable to the production of both goods. Some resources are better suited for producing Good A, while others are better suited for producing Good B. As more and more resources are shifted towards the production of Good B, the resources that are less suited for producing Good B have to be used. This leads to a decrease in the productivity of these resources and an increase in the opportunity cost Not complicated — just consistent. And it works..

A straight-line PPF indicates constant opportunity costs, meaning that resources are perfectly adaptable between the production of the two goods. This is a less realistic scenario but can be used for simplifying the model.

Key Concepts Illustrated by the PPF

The Production Possibilities Frontier illustrates several fundamental economic concepts:

  1. Scarcity: The PPF highlights the fundamental economic problem of scarcity. Because resources are limited, society must make choices about which goods and services to produce. The PPF shows the limits to what can be produced given the available resources and technology.
  2. Trade-offs: The PPF illustrates the trade-offs inherent in resource allocation. Producing more of one good requires producing less of another. This is because resources are limited, and shifting resources from one use to another involves an opportunity cost.
  3. Opportunity Cost: The PPF visually represents the opportunity cost of producing one good in terms of the other. The slope of the PPF at any given point represents the opportunity cost of producing one more unit of the good on the x-axis in terms of the amount of the good on the y-axis that must be sacrificed.
  4. Efficiency: Points on the PPF represent efficient production. So in practice, it is impossible to produce more of one good without producing less of the other. Resources are being fully utilized, and there is no waste. Points inside the PPF represent inefficient production, indicating that resources are not being fully utilized or are being used ineffectively.
  5. Economic Growth: Economic growth is represented by an outward shift of the PPF. So in practice, the economy can now produce more of both goods than it could before. Economic growth can be caused by an increase in the quantity of resources, an improvement in technology, or an increase in the efficiency with which resources are used.

Factors that Shift the PPF

The PPF is not static. It can shift over time due to changes in the underlying assumptions. Factors that can shift the PPF include:

  • Changes in Resource Availability: An increase in the quantity of resources, such as an increase in the labor force, the discovery of new natural resources, or an increase in the stock of capital, will shift the PPF outward, allowing the economy to produce more of both goods. Conversely, a decrease in the quantity of resources, such as a natural disaster that destroys resources or a decrease in the labor force due to emigration, will shift the PPF inward, reducing the economy's production possibilities.
  • Technological Advancements: Improvements in technology can increase the efficiency with which resources are used, allowing the economy to produce more of both goods with the same amount of resources. Technological advancements shift the PPF outward. Here's one way to look at it: the invention of the assembly line dramatically increased the productivity of manufacturing, allowing for greater output with the same input.
  • Changes in Education and Skills: Investments in education and training can improve the skills and productivity of the labor force. A more skilled workforce can produce more goods and services with the same amount of resources, shifting the PPF outward.
  • Changes in Capital Stock: Increasing the amount of capital available (e.g., machinery, equipment, and infrastructure) allows for increased production efficiency and shifts the PPF outwards. Investments in infrastructure, like roads and communication networks, can support production and distribution, expanding the PPF.

Applications of the PPF

The Production Possibilities Frontier has numerous applications in economics and can be used to analyze a variety of issues, including:

  • Policy Decisions: Governments can use the PPF to evaluate the trade-offs associated with different policy choices. Take this: a government that wants to increase military spending must consider the opportunity cost in terms of reduced spending on other areas, such as education or healthcare.
  • Economic Development: The PPF can be used to illustrate the potential for economic growth and development. Developing countries often have PPFs that are closer to the origin, reflecting their limited resources and technology. By investing in education, infrastructure, and technology, these countries can shift their PPFs outward and improve their standard of living.
  • International Trade: The PPF can be used to illustrate the gains from international trade. By specializing in the production of goods in which they have a comparative advantage and trading with other countries, countries can consume beyond their own PPFs.
  • Resource Allocation: Businesses can use the PPF to make decisions about how to allocate their resources. As an example, a company that produces both cars and trucks must decide how to allocate its resources between the two products. The PPF can help the company to identify the most efficient production levels.
  • Impact of External Shocks: The PPF can be used to analyze the impact of external shocks, such as natural disasters or economic crises. These events can reduce the availability of resources or disrupt production processes, causing the PPF to shift inward.

Examples of Production Possibilities

To further illustrate the concept of the PPF, let's consider a few examples:

  • Guns vs. Butter: This classic example illustrates the trade-off between military spending (guns) and civilian goods (butter). A country that spends more on its military will have fewer resources available for producing consumer goods, and vice versa. The PPF shows the maximum combinations of guns and butter that can be produced given the country's resources and technology.
  • Agriculture vs. Manufacturing: This example illustrates the trade-off between producing agricultural goods (e.g., food) and manufactured goods (e.g., cars, electronics). A country that focuses on agriculture may have a lower standard of living than a country that focuses on manufacturing, as manufactured goods tend to be more valuable and can be exported to earn foreign exchange.
  • Healthcare vs. Education: This example illustrates the trade-off between investing in healthcare and investing in education. A country that spends more on healthcare may have a healthier population, but it may also have a less educated population. A country that spends more on education may have a more skilled workforce, but it may also have a less healthy population.
  • Consumer Goods vs. Capital Goods: This example shows the trade-off between producing goods for immediate consumption (consumer goods) and goods used to produce other goods (capital goods). A nation that focuses on producing consumer goods might enjoy a higher standard of living in the short term. On the flip side, a nation that focuses on producing capital goods, such as machinery and equipment, can increase its future production possibilities by enhancing its productive capacity.

Criticisms of the PPF

While the PPF is a valuable tool for understanding basic economic concepts, it also has some limitations:

  • Simplifying Assumptions: The PPF relies on several simplifying assumptions that may not hold in the real world. Here's one way to look at it: the assumption that there are only two goods being produced is unrealistic, as most economies produce a wide variety of goods and services. The assumption of fixed resources and technology is also unrealistic, as resources and technology are constantly changing.
  • Static Model: The PPF is a static model, meaning that it represents the economy at a single point in time. It does not take into account the dynamic processes of economic growth and development.
  • Ignores Distribution: The PPF focuses on the efficiency of production but does not address the distribution of goods and services. It is possible for an economy to be producing efficiently (i.e., on the PPF) but for the distribution of income and wealth to be highly unequal.
  • Difficulty in Measurement: In practice, it can be difficult to accurately measure the PPF for a real-world economy. This is because it is difficult to determine the maximum potential output of all goods and services given the available resources and technology.

Despite these limitations, the PPF remains a valuable tool for understanding basic economic concepts and for analyzing a variety of policy issues. It provides a simplified framework for thinking about scarcity, trade-offs, opportunity cost, efficiency, and economic growth.

The PPF and Real-World Applications

Despite the simplifying assumptions, the PPF framework provides valuable insights into real-world scenarios:

  • Resource Allocation During Pandemics: During a pandemic, a nation may have to shift resources from producing regular consumer goods and services to producing healthcare equipment, vaccines, and other medical necessities. This shift can be visualized as a movement along the PPF, where an increase in healthcare production leads to a decrease in the production of other goods and services.
  • Impact of Trade Policies: Trade policies like tariffs and quotas can affect a country's production possibilities. A country that imposes tariffs on imported goods may encourage domestic production of those goods, but it may also lead to inefficiencies and a decrease in overall production possibilities.
  • Investment in Renewable Energy: A country that invests in renewable energy technologies can shift its PPF outward over time. By developing more sustainable energy sources, the country can reduce its reliance on fossil fuels and increase its long-term production possibilities.
  • The Role of Innovation: Continuous innovation and technological advancements are crucial for shifting the PPF outward. Countries that invest in research and development and grow a culture of innovation are more likely to experience sustained economic growth and improve their standard of living.
